Bowling Green vs. Buffalo Betting Odds & Expert Picks: November 21st 2008

November 21st, 2008

The Buffalo Bulls enter this game playing some of their most impressive football, and are on a four-game win streak. The last time Buffalo played they got an exciting, 43-40 overtime win over the Zips, making their league record 4-2, which puts them in first place in the East Division. As for the Falcons, they have won back-to-back contests, winning against Kent State, 45-30, and Ohio, 28-3. With the two wins, Bowling Green are now 5-5 overall, and 3-3 in league play. If Bowling Green can get a win in its last two games the team will win the East Division, and a chance to compete in the MAC title game. In terms of the all- time series between the two teams on the field, the Falcons have won four of the last five meetings.
